Lyrica is not a cure for fibromyalgia, but it may help control your symptoms. It can take several weeks before you feel the benefits. Exactly how Lyrica works is unknown. Fibromyalgia symptoms have been linked to changes in the brain that influence how people perceive pain.
People with fibromyalgia experience a heightened sensitivity to stimuli that are not normally painful to others. Lyrica was approved by the FDA for the treatment of fibromyalgia in adults 18 years and older in Marketed by Pfizer, it was previously approved for the management of diabetic peripheral neuropathy , post-herpetic neuralgia, and as an additional therapy for adults with partial onset seizures. Until the approval of Lyrica capsules, no medicine was specifically approved to treat fibromyalgia.
Symptoms of fibromyalgia had been treated with:. These medications act as antidepressants while Lyrica does not. Because of the possibility of dizziness or drowsiness, the drug may impair your ability to drive or operate complex machinery. Some people have reported allergic reactions to Lyrica, including swelling of the face, mouth, lips, gums, tongue, and neck. Others experienced trouble breathing, rash, hives, and blisters. If any of these symptoms occur, you should stop taking Lyrica immediately and seek medical care.
A small number of people, about 1 in , may have suicidal thoughts or actions with Lyrica, as is common for antiepileptic drugs. Don't stop taking the medication, but contact your healthcare provider if you have such thoughts or if you have anxiety, depression, irritability, agitation, or other unusual behavior that is new or worsening.

Pregabalin has been a controlled medicine since 1 April This means there are strict rules on how it's prescribed and dispensed to make sure it's not given to the wrong person or misused.
When you collect pregabalin your pharmacist will ask for proof of identity such as your passport or driving licence. You'll also be asked to sign the back of your prescription, to confirm that you've received it. If you're collecting pregabalin for someone else, you're legally required to show the pharmacist proof of your identity if asked. Your pregabalin prescription will probably need to be hand signed by a doctor.

Do not drive a car or ride a bike if pregabalin makes you sleepy, gives you blurred vision or makes you feel dizzy, clumsy or unable to concentrate or make decisions. This may be more likely when you first start taking pregabalin but could happen at any time - for example when starting another medicine.
It's an offence to drive a car if your ability to drive safely is affected. It's your responsibility to decide if it's safe to drive. If you're in any doubt, do not drive. UK has more information on the law on drugs and driving.
Talk to your doctor or pharmacist if you're unsure whether it's safe for you to drive while taking pregabalin. Lyrica may cause respiratory depression slow and shallow breathing if taken with other drugs that cause sedation severe sleepiness or respiratory depression.
Opioids are a type of drug that can cause these side effects. Tramadol is an example of an opioid medication that can cause respiratory depression and sedation. Taking Lyrica and tramadol together may increase your risk for severe side effects.
Lyrica can affect your central nervous system CNS. Your CNS is made up of your brain and spinal cord. Your spinal cord has nerves that your brain uses to send signals throughout your body. This may cause symptoms such as sedation severe sleepiness and respiratory depression. Your doctor may adjust the dosage of one or more of your medications, or they may have you try a different medication for your condition. Lyrica may interact with certain diabetes drugs called thiazolidinediones.
Both thiazolidinediones and Lyrica can cause swelling in your hands, feet, and legs. Taking Lyrica with thiazolidinediones may raise your risk for swelling, as well as weight gain. If you take these drugs together, your doctor will likely monitor you for any symptoms of swelling or unusual weight gain. Your doctor may adjust your dosage of Lyrica or the thiazolidinedione, or they may have you try a different drug to treat your condition.
